Our nervous system is responsible for coordinating human body behaviour and transmitting signals between different body parts. In vertebrates it consists of two main parts known as the Central Nervous System (CNS) and the Peripheral Nervous System (PNS). The CNS consists of the brain and spinal cord. The PNS consists of nerves that are long fibers connecting the CNS to every other part of the body.
